Ocean Animal Busy Bag

Print out this adorable Ocean Animal Game for preschoolers for your own ocean animal busy bag. Work on their skills of one-to-one, matching, patterning, and number recognition!

Ocean Themed Game for Preschoolers for Busy Bag

It’s time for Busy Bag of the Month!

This month we’re exploring the theme of the ocean! We’ve been spending a lot of time at the beach this summer and were looking for ways to have fun at home to keep those memories in our minds. I’ve created a fun little Ocean Animal Game to help us remember the animals we discovered and learned about this summer.  

Plus we’ll work on some math skills of one-to-one, matching, patterning and number recognition!

Here are the activities that you can do with just a few simple items in a bag!  Perfect for learning at home and on the go!

Activity #1

Match the Ocean Animals to the “Let’s Explore the Ocean Mat”

Activity # 2

Sort the Ocean Animals into matching groups

Activity #3

Create Patterns with the Ocean Animals

Activity #4

Pull a number from the number pile and place that amount of Ocean Animals into the water.

Activity #5

Make your own ocean with printables or draw an image
